This afternoon the senior class will participate in a workshop called College 101 to help prepare them for college life. The program, sponsored by the Women’s Club, will provide seniors the opportunity to learn valuable information from professionals on topics such as legal rights and responsibilities of college students, campus safety, money management suggestions and life on a college campus.
Parents are invited to lunch from 11 a.m. - noon to hear the same speakers.
